Transaction 4e146f443501ed166b2e9a90fe5c262ab95a7ec5dfd41e9ce634a21f90981f91

1 Input
2 Outputs
  • 4e146f443501ed166b2e9a90fe5c262ab95a7ec5dfd41e9ce634a21f90981f91:0
  • value  25000000
    address  1PuEGjrmX6sFHbWx44Qun52spCEsQ38haL
  • 4e146f443501ed166b2e9a90fe5c262ab95a7ec5dfd41e9ce634a21f90981f91:1
  • value  95076041242
    address  1Ek3M2XQBrkwEWBDEiFzyxS6YyMhqcaSht